Output 6cf5893e42ab6217864885d0d0a48d10af5963fa24177390766872cbde5787e3:1

value
64885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fb6e2a027037744e2ef46d36b62e02040326b79 OP_EQUAL
address
34ahxaeJNhdUczEhNXQSmpZA4pSkqotwtB
transaction
6cf5893e42ab6217864885d0d0a48d10af5963fa24177390766872cbde5787e3
spent
true